Components of Closing Costs
Closing costs for sellers in Woodhaven generally include real estate agent commissions, title insurance, and transfer taxes. The commission is often the largest expense, usually around 5% to 6% of the sale price. Title insurance protects the buyer and lender against any title defects, while transfer taxes are state and local fees for transferring property ownership. How Do Closing Costs Affect Sellers in Woodhaven?
Impact on Net Proceeds
The Sonic Title team has found that understanding closing costs is vital for sellers to accurately estimate their net proceeds from a sale. For example, if your Woodhaven home sells for the median price of $199,000, closing costs could range from $11,940 to $19,900. This range can significantly affect your financial planning post-sale. Local Market Considerations
In Woodhaven, the real estate market dynamics can influence closing costs. For instance, in a seller's market, you might have more leverage to negotiate who pays certain fees. Conversely, in a buyer's market, sellers might need to cover more costs to make their property attractive. Can Closing Costs Be Negotiated?
A question we frequently hear at Sonic Title is: "Can closing costs be negotiated?" The answer is yes, to some extent. While certain costs like taxes are fixed, others, such as agent commissions and title services, can sometimes be negotiated. Sellers in Woodhaven should discuss these possibilities with their real estate agents and title service providers to explore potential savings. Who Typically Pays the Closing Costs?
Another common question is: "Who pays the closing costs?" Typically, the seller covers the real estate commission and transfer taxes, while the buyer pays for the inspection and appraisal fees. However, this can vary by agreement. Sonic Title suggests reviewing your sale contract carefully to understand all financial obligations and avoid surprises at closing. In some cases, sellers may offer to cover a portion of the buyer's closing costs to incentivize a quicker sale.
